Oktoberfest
October 2022: Ein Prosit
More than a tradition, Oktoberfest at the Yacht Club de Monaco has become an institution. In an ambiance worthy of the Bavarian brasseries, this party is organised by members from the German community and every year brings together 500 beer fans, the ladies festive in Dirndl dresses, the men in Lederhose.
Instigated by Anne-Marie Winkler and Laila Schlereth, supported by many other members of the active German community, the YCM is transformed into a big brasserie decked out in the white and blue colours of the Bavarian flag.
Smart & Sustainable Marina
25-26 September 2022
A sustainable ecosystem approach for a positive impact
Organised by Monaco Marina Management (M3), the one-day Monaco Smart & Sustainable Marina Rendezvous gathered key players in the sector, investors, developers, industrialists and innovators to promote development of eco-responsible marinas that are efficient, attractive and lively places where people want to be. The day focused on high-level discussions between decision-makers in the marina ecosystem, keen to invest in innovative solutions that meet their environmental and business challenges. The spotlight was on the most promising and most innovative solutions to encourage their take-up by the sector. Supported by the Prince Albert II of Monaco Foundation, the event was hosted by Yacht Club de Monaco, a platform for promoting and exchanging views on initiatives in favour of an eco-responsible approach to yachting, at sea and ashore.

Environmental Symposium
Next Rendezvous: March 2023
During the Monaco Ocean Week
As part of Monaco Ocean Week, organised by the Prince Albert II Foundation and the Monaco Government, in partnership with the Monaco Oceanographic Institute & Scientific Centre of Monaco, Yacht Club de Monaco is organising, in March 2023, its 12th La Belle Classe Superyachts Environmental Symposium a one day conference for owners and captains, under the aegis of its ‘Monaco Capital of Advanced Yachting’ project.

Business Symposium
The industry and its shipowners
Next rendezvous : February 2023
An annual gathering for the yachting industry, the La Belle Classe Superyachts Business Symposium is an opportunity to analyse developments, challenges and problems in the sector. Organised by the Yacht Club de Monaco as a dinner-debate, it is also a chance for professionals and owners to meet each year in a relaxed friendly ambiance at an always informative event.

Monaco Yacht Show
28 Sept. - 1st October 2022: Yachting's flagship event!
An iconic event combining exclusivity, excellence and innovation, the Monaco Yacht Show has established itself and maintained its position over the years as the international meeting for the superyacht sector.
A rigorous selection of exhibitors ensures a top quality show, with 500 major companies in the sector represented and 105 outstanding super and mega-yachts exhibited every year.

With an average 33,000 participants, the MYS offers a unique occasion in the year for yachting company heads to meet and discover the latest hi-tech products and luxury services.
During the four-day show, more than 80 events are organised by exhibitors in Monte-Carlo’s top luxury hotels, on board yachts and, for the first time, in the Yacht Club’s new building.

YCM Explorer Awards
March 2023
YCM Explorer Awards by La Belle Classe Superyachts recognise owners who take their environmental responsibilities seriously. They are presented by the Club’s President, HSH Prince Albert II, at the end of a one-day Environmental Symposium, organised by the YCM during Monaco Ocean Week in March.
The major criteria for these awards are the owner’s conception of their superyacht, how they use it and what it can do for humanity. It could be a technical innovation that significantly reduces the yacht’s CO2 emissions, the assistance given to scientists, or just an ability to pass on and share adventures at sea so that many more people come to respect, love and protect the Ocean. These men and women are tomorrow’s explorers and all perpetuate the YCM’s ‘Art de Vivre la Mer’ philosophy which is at the heart of the Club’s core values.
